Adobe
PDF file format is ideal for the electronic distribution of electronic
documents. PDF files are compact and keep their original layout,
features which make them perfect to be downloaded and printed
by the user at home or to be consulted on screen, where several
interactive options are possible.

Observations
- "Acrobat
Reader" will automatically start running whenever a PDF
file is open, should that happen by clicking on a link or by
opening a file that is recorded in the hard disk, to show the
document requested.
- In order
to save a PDF document in your computer before opening it, just
click on the link for the document with the right button of
your mouse, choose the option "Save link/target as"
and point out where the PDF file should be saved.
Troubleshooting
A)
If the user opens more than 10 pages simultaneously using Acrobat
Reader in Internet Explorer 4.0, the following message will appear:
Error "Maximum
number of files" When viewing PDF files in Internet Explorer
4.0.
To solve
such problem, that is, to be able to open any number of pages
simultaneously, it is only necessary to run the "Adobe
Acrobat Control for Activex" software (ocxinst.exe), which
can be downloaded from the following address:
http://www.adobe.com/prodindex/acrobat/ocxdnld.html
1. Such
software is only required for Internet Explorer 4.0. It is not
necessary for Netscape 4.0.
2. To install:
a) Download
file ocxinst.exe
b) Close
Internet Explorer 4.0
c) Close
Adobe Acrobat (Reader)
d) Double-click
on file ocxinst.exe
e) Follow
the instructions on the screen.

B)
The user may face some difficulties to visualize PDF files due
to the file size and subsequent problems in retrieving it from
the Internet. If that is the case, we recommend saving the
document to the computer in order to access it afterwards.
How
is this done?
To
save the document before accessing it, click on the link with
the right button of your mouse. Select the option "Save
link/target as" and choose the folder where you would like
the file to be saved. After the document is downloaded, double-click
on the file and wait to visualize the document.
